RENO, Nev. (AP) — Reno police are investigating the death of a pedestrian who was struck by a car in accident that shut down part of North Virginia Street during the morning commute.
No details have been released about the victim who was hit and killed in a crosswalk in front of the Bonanza Casino about 5 a.m. Monday.
Police say the driver is cooperating with investigators.
Virginia Street was expected to remain closed for several hours between Parr Boulevard and Panther Drive.
